How they compare

Polynesia currently reports -12.74 % change on previous year against -15.93 % change on previous year in Democratic People's Republic of Korea, a difference of 3.19 % change on previous year.

The two have swapped places 20 times across 42 shared years of data; in 1983 it was Polynesia ahead.

Democratic People's Republic of Korea ranks 17th and Polynesia ranks 14th of 21 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Democratic People's Republic of Korea averaged higher in 3 and Polynesia in 2.
